Web8 nov. 2024 · For finding smallest element we do same steps i.e initialize min as first element and for every traversed element, compare it with min, if it is smaller than min, then update min. Another method is finding largest and smallest by using library functions std::max_element and std::min_element, respectively. Web这篇文章将讨论如何在 C++ 中找到Vector中的最小值或最大值。 1.使用 std::max_element. 这 std::min_element 和 std::max_element 分别返回指定范围内的最小值和最大值的迭代器。以下代码示例显示了对这两个函数的调用:
C++ Tutorial => Find max and min Element and Respective Index in a
Web12 apr. 2024 · Vectors and unique pointers. Sandor Dargo 11 hours ago. 8 min. In this post, I want to share some struggles I had twice during the last few months. For one of my examples, I wanted to initialize a std::vector with std::unique_ptr. It didn’t compile and I had little time, I didn’t even think about it. I waved my hand and changed my example. Web21 apr. 2024 · Effectively, you test the same condition twice: ( (2 * i) + 1) < heap.size () - 1 in left, and l != -1 in heapify. Notice that anytime right is valid, left is also valid. That allows a certain optimization (see below). C++ is very good in recognizing tail recursion and optimizing it out. I strongly recommend to do it explicitly anyway. fontana shelter
std::min_element in C++ - GeeksforGeeks
Webmin function template std:: min C++98 C++11 C++14 Return the smallest Returns the smallest of a and b. If both are equivalent, a is returned. The versions for initializer lists (3) return the smallest of all the elements in the list. Returning the first of them if these are more than one. WebRead More Check if a vector contains duplicates in C++. Index of Minimum Value: 1. Minimum Value: 22. It returned the index position of minimum value of the vector. In this case, the minimum value of vector is 22 and its index position is 1, because the indexing in C++ starts from 0. Web13 jun. 2024 · Verwenden Sie die Funktionen std::max_element und std::min_element, um den Maximal- und Minimalwert aus einem Vektor in C++ zu erhalten Um die maximalen und minimalen Werte aus einem Vektor in C++ zu finden, können wir die Funktionen std::max_element bzw. std::min_element verwenden. eileen\u0027s dream by cao